Reese Witherspoon got emotional honoring late starDiane Keatonat her company Hello Sunshine's Shine Away event on Saturday, October 11.
Speaking to the audience, the 49-year-old actress described the late star as her first mentor, recalling the advice that the Annie Hall actress gave her while she was filming Wildflower.
"I was 15 years old, and I was from Nashville, Tenn., and I didn't know anybody," Reese said at the event, which took place hours after the news of Diane's death broke.
For those unversed, Diane passed away in California on Oct. 11. She was 79.
Reese starred in the 1991 film Wildflower, which was directed by Diane.
“I auditioned for her, and she looked at me after. I came in with this big country accent, and I was playing this little southern girl, and she goes, ‘Who are you?' " theBig Little Lies actress reflected on.
“I said, ‘I'm Reese Witherspoon and I'm from Nashville, Tenn.,'” Reese continued. “And she said, ‘Are you making that up? That accent you're doing?’ And I said, ‘No, ma'am. I'm from Nashville, Tenn., and I'm here, and I'd love to be in your movie.""
"And she was like, ‘Well, you're hired. You're hired today, tomorrow, and the next day. I don't know who you are, but I am so excited to have you," added the Fear actress.
Sharing the advice she received from Diane, the mom-of-three said that “She really took the time to pull me aside and say, ‘Stand up straight, okay? I want you to have good posture. If you're going to be an actress, you've got to work on your posture.’“
“I was like, ‘Okay, Ms. Keaton,’“ added Reese.
